Choose the one which best expresses the meaning of:
COUNTERMAND
A. Criticise
B. Cancel
C. Devastate
D. Intrigue

Hint: In this question we need to look for the word which has similar or closest meaning to the given word ‘COUNTERMAND’. Or two words with a nearly common meaning or same meaning words.

Complete answer:
The word countermand means: to cancel an order, to revoke a command, etc. If someone countermand it means by giving different orders he can cancel it or take it back, make it reverse, can undo it, etc.

Now let’s examine and understand the given option above.
> Criticise: The word criticise means: talk behind someone’s back, backbiting, to talk in such a way that the other person is wrong, to talk negatively about someone, to judge someone, sharing opinion in a bad or negative way . So it is neither related nor appropriate to answer for the given question.
Example: Whenever she meets me she criticises her friends.

> Devastated: The word devastated means: Extremely upset, sad, shocked, unhappy, ruined, shattered, crushed, etc. This word is basically used for bad emotion. So, it is neither related nor appropriate to answer the given question.
Example: Disaster devastated or ruined many people’s lives.

> Intrigue: The word intrigue means: curiosity, interest by unusual, to make someone very interested, to make secret plans which are especially bad, etc. So, it is neither related nor appropriate to answer the given question.
Example: I guided mathematics to one of my friends by using an easier way that intrigued him towards math.

> Cancel: Here the word cancel has the same meaning: disapproval of something, to announce that whatever we have been planning that will not happen, to stop something, to decide not to conduct. As it is related, nearest and appropriate answer for the given question.
So the right answer will be option [B] Cancel.
